How do you know if your wheels need alignment?
- Uneven or rapid tire wear, such as feathering or balding on one edge, is a key sign for a 1990 Toyota Supra.
- Steering wheel drift or the vehicle pulling to one side at moderate speeds indicates alignment issues.
- Vibrations through the steering wheel, especially at highway speeds, can signal misalignment or suspension wear.
- Reduced fuel economy and inconsistent handling often accompany wheel misalignment over time.

How often should you get a four wheel alignment?
- As a guideline, check alignment every 6,000ā12,000 miles or at least once a year for the 1990 Toyota Supraāsooner if you notice symptoms.
- After hitting curbs, potholes, or after suspension repairs, schedule an alignment immediately to prevent accelerated tire wear.
- Regular alignment checks preserve handling, safety, and fuel economy, and help avoid costly repairs to tires and suspension parts.
